New Jersey Statutes, Title: 52, STATE GOVERNMENT, DEPARTMENTS AND OFFICERS
Chapter 27d: Establishment
Section: 52:27d-181: Finality and conclusiveness of determination by director; anticipation of state aid by municipality
Any determination of the director pursuant to this act as to the amount of State aid allowable to each qualifying municipality shall be final and conclusive, and no appeal shall be taken therefrom or any review thereof, except in the case of an arithmetical or typographical error in the calculation of any distribution of funds. Notwithstanding any provisions of the Local Budget Law (N.J.S. 40A:4-1 et seq.), any municipality qualifying for State aid under this act may anticipate the receipt of the amount of State aid included for the purposes of this act in the Governor's annual budget message.
L.1978, c. 14, s. 4, eff. March 30, 1978.
